We are a member of the South Vancouver Island (SVI) Minor Softball Association and the BC Amateur Softball Association (Softball BC), the official Provincial Sport Organization for Softball/Fastball in B.C.
Our mission is to engage the youth of our community in healthy activity through learning and appreciating the sport of softball and encouraging the development of not only softball skills but life skills. We aim to provide quality softball instruction in the fundamental aspects of the game in a safe, fun, positive and nurturing environment, teaching these young athletes to strive to be their best and to have success on and off the diamond.

Softball BC Number
To participate in Beacon Hill softball programs, every player and coach is required to obtain a Softball BC membership. It is a one-time fee of $10 for a lifetime membership. You will need to provide us with your membership number when you register.
